LinkedIn Sales Navigator is a premium LinkedIn tool designed to help sales professionals identify and engage potential buyers through advanced search filters, lead recommendations, and direct messaging features.

LinkedIn Sales Navigator is a premium sales tool designed to help professionals find, understand, and engage with potential buyers on LinkedIn. It offers advanced search features, lead recommendations, and personalized insights to improve social selling efforts and build stronger client relationships.

How LinkedIn Sales Navigator Works

LinkedIn Sales Navigator provides users with advanced search filters that go beyond the standard LinkedIn search capabilities. This allows sales professionals to pinpoint prospects based on criteria like industry, company size, seniority, and geography. Users can save leads and accounts to monitor updates and stay informed about potential opportunities.

The platform also offers personalized lead recommendations powered by LinkedIn’s data and algorithms. These suggestions help salespeople discover new prospects who closely match their ideal customer profile. Additionally, Sales Navigator integrates with CRM systems, enabling seamless data synchronization and workflow efficiency.

Another key feature is InMail messaging, which allows users to contact prospects directly even without a prior connection. This increases outreach possibilities while maintaining a professional tone. Users also receive real-time alerts on job changes, company news, and shared posts, helping them engage prospects at the right moment.

Why LinkedIn Sales Navigator Matters

In today’s digital sales environment, building authentic relationships is crucial. LinkedIn Sales Navigator equips professionals with the tools to identify and connect with the right decision-makers efficiently. According to LinkedIn’s data, users of Sales Navigator see 45% more opportunities created and 51% more pipeline generated compared to non-users (LinkedIn Business Blog).

By providing deeper insights into prospects’ activities and interests, Sales Navigator helps sales teams tailor their outreach and messaging, increasing the likelihood of meaningful engagement. This targeted approach saves time and reduces wasted effort, making sales processes more productive.

For businesses focused on social selling, Sales Navigator complements strategies measured by the Social Selling Index. It enhances prospecting and relationship-building capabilities, proving essential for competitive advantage in B2B sales.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is LinkedIn Sales Navigator worth the investment for small businesses?

Yes. While it involves a subscription fee, Sales Navigator’s ability to target high-quality leads and facilitate direct outreach can accelerate growth and improve return on investment, especially for small businesses focused on B2B sales.

Can I use LinkedIn Sales Navigator without a LinkedIn Premium account?

No. LinkedIn Sales Navigator is a separate premium service that requires its own subscription, independent of LinkedIn Premium personal accounts. It offers specialized features tailored to sales professionals.
